Choosing the Right Happy Birthday Flyer Background
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ty of choosing the perfect background for your happy birthday flyer. It's not just about picking something pretty; it's about making a strategic choice that supports your overall design goals. First off, consider your audience. Who are you trying to reach? A background that works wonders for a child's party might not be the best fit for a milestone birthday celebration for adults. Age and interests are super important considerations. Next, think about the party's theme, if there is one. A luau calls for tropical vibes, while a casino night needs a touch of glitz and glamour. The theme can dictate colors, patterns, and even the type of imagery you use. It's a great starting point for brainstorming your backgrounds. You can also get inspiration from other sources. Check out templates online or browse through other birthday flyers for ideas. Just be careful not to straight-up copy anyone's work, but use it as a source of inspiration. One of the major tips to consider is the color palette. Color psychology is a real thing, you know? Different colors evoke different emotions. Bright, vibrant colors like red, yellow, and orange are great for creating a sense of energy and excitement. More subtle hues like blues, greens, and pastels can convey a sense of calm and sophistication.
Consider the information you want to present on your flyer. This includes the birthday person's name, the date, time, location, and any special instructions (like “bring a dish to share”). Your background should complement this information, not compete with it. A background that's too busy can make the text difficult to read, so a clean and simple background is often the best choice. Finally, remember that you have options. You can create your own background from scratch using design software, or you can use a pre-designed template. You can also download free or paid stock photos and graphics. Just make sure to check the licensing requirements before using any images. In short, picking a background is all about balancing the aesthetic and the practical. By keeping these factors in mind, you'll be well on your way to designing a truly fantastic birthday flyer. Design Styles for Your Happy Birthday Flyer Backgrounds
Now let's delve into some popular design styles that can really elevate your happy birthday flyer backgrounds. This is where the creative fun begins, guys! First off, we have the ever-popular minimalist style. This approach focuses on simplicity, clean lines, and a limited color palette. Think of it as the 'less is more' approach. A minimalist background is perfect when you want the birthday information to be the star. You might use a solid color background, a subtle texture, or a simple pattern. Next, we have the vintage style, which evokes nostalgia with its retro fonts, textures, and color schemes. This is a great choice for birthdays celebrating milestones or for parties with a classic theme. You might incorporate distressed textures, faded colors, and vintage photographs. It's a great option for a more old-school approach. Let's move on to the modern style. Modern designs often incorporate bold colors, geometric shapes, and a contemporary aesthetic. This is a fantastic option if you want to create a flyer that feels fresh and up-to-date. You could use bold color blocks, abstract patterns, or modern typography.
Then there's the themed style. This is where you tailor your background to match the party's theme. A pirate-themed party could have a background with a treasure map, while a superhero party could feature comic book graphics or cityscapes. Be creative here! In addition, we have the photographic style, which uses high-quality photographs as the background. This can be an image of the birthday person, a group of friends, or a scenic location. Just be sure that the image is clear and that the text is easy to read against it. It's a good approach to showcase a photo of the birthday person. You can also go for the illustrated style, which uses hand-drawn or digitally illustrated elements as the background. This is a great way to add a unique and personalized touch to your flyer. The last one on our list is abstract. Abstract backgrounds feature non-representational patterns, shapes, and colors. This style is fantastic for creating a visually dynamic and eye-catching flyer. Color Palettes for Birthday Flyer Backgrounds
Alright, let's talk colors, because the right color palette can totally make or break your happy birthday flyer. Colors are more than just a visual element; they communicate emotions, create a mood, and help grab attention. Understanding color psychology is a game changer! Let’s break it down, guys. First, we have bright and bold color palettes. These are perfect for creating excitement and energy. Think of vibrant reds, yellows, and oranges. These colors shout “party!” and are perfect for children's birthdays or any event that aims to be fun and lively. Next up are the soft and pastel palettes. Pastel colors like baby blue, lavender, and mint green are amazing for creating a gentle and sophisticated vibe. Great for milestone birthdays or parties with a more elegant feel. Moving on to classic and elegant palettes. Classic combinations include gold, black, and white. They create a sense of sophistication and can be used to celebrate milestone birthdays or formal events. Using these colors can give a sense of prestige. Then there is the monochromatic approach, which involves using different shades and tones of a single color. This creates a cohesive and visually appealing design. You might use different shades of blue, green, or purple. The next is complementary palettes, which involve using colors that are opposite each other on the color wheel. For example, red and green, or blue and orange. These color combinations create a high-contrast design that is visually striking. Let’s not forget the analogous palette which uses col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. This creates a harmonious and visually pleasing design. Examples include using shades of blue, green, and yellow. Finally, the themed palette is a way of adapting your colors to the theme. You can use colors that match a specific theme such as a pirate party or a superhero party.
Tips and Tricks for Designing Your Flyer Background
Alright, let's get into some pro tips to help you create truly stunning happy birthday flyer backgrounds. Firstly, keep it readable. Make sure your background doesn’t make the text hard to read. High contrast between the text and background is a must. If your background is busy, consider using a solid color block behind the text to make it stand out. Next, choose high-quality images. If you're using photographs or graphics, ensure they are high resolution. Blurry images look unprofessional and can detract from your design. High-quality images make everything look better! Let's talk about typography. Pick fonts that complement your background and the overall design. Consider using contrasting fonts for the headline and the body text. Make it attractive, and think about the overall layout. Consider the balance and composition. Don't overcrowd the flyer. Use negative space to create visual interest and to give the design room to breathe. Don’t be afraid to experiment. Try different combinations of colors, patterns, and images to see what works best. Play around with different layouts until you find one that looks good. Then, get feedback from others. Show your design to friends or family and ask for their opinions. A fresh perspective can help you identify any areas that need improvement. Keep it simple, unless you want to make a statement. Sometimes, less is more. A simple, well-designed background can be more effective than a busy one. But it depends on the style you are going for! Finally, consider using templates. They can save you a ton of time and effort. There are tons of free and paid templates available online, which you can customize to fit your needs. Where to Find Awesome Flyer Backgrounds
Okay, now that you're armed with all this knowledge, where do you actually find these amazing backgrounds? Let's explore some resources, guys! First off, we have stock photo websites, which are your best friends. Websites like Unsplash, Pexels, and Pixabay offer a vast library of free, high-quality images. These are great for finding photographs and graphics to use as your background. Make sure you check the licensing requirements before using any images. Next, we have graphic design software. Tools like Canva, Adobe Photoshop, and Adobe Illustrator allow you to create your own backgrounds from scratch. This gives you complete control over the design, but it does require some design skills. Some of these come with pre-designed backgrounds. You can also look to online design templates. Websites like Canva and other design platforms offer a wide variety of pre-designed templates that you can customize. This is a great option if you're not a designer or if you're short on time. Then, there are royalty-free graphics sites. Websites like Shutterstock and Getty Images offer a wide selection of royalty-free graphics and images that you can purchase and use for your flyers. Make sure to check the licensing requirements and credit the artist if required. Finally, if you are looking for something more unique, hire a designer. A professional graphic designer can create a custom background for your flyer that perfectly matches your vision. This option is more expensive, but it ensures that your flyer stands out from the crowd.
